by Paul Vorndran Third-party asset recovery companies advertise directly to investors known to be victims of investment fraud. A third-party asset recovery company gathers information regarding scams after they have become public, and targets the investors of those scams offering recovery services. According to the North American Securities Administrators Association (NASAA), these firms employ high… Read more »
